LSports has signed a multi-year agreement with Caliente Interactive that will see the operator integrate the supplier’s data services across its sports betting platforms in Latin America.
Under the partnership, Caliente will use LSports’ real-time data feeds to support its pre-match and in-play sportsbook offering. The agreement also covers services related to fan engagement, odds management and risk management.
The deal comes as sports betting operators across Latin America continue to invest in platform capabilities following regulatory developments in key markets, including Brazil.
LSports provides sports data covering more than 100 sports, over 15,000 leagues and more than 250,000 events each month. The company supplies data and trading services to operators and other stakeholders across the sports betting sector.
According to the companies, the agreement is designed to support Caliente’s sportsbook operations across the region by providing access to real-time data and related trading infrastructure.
The partnership also reflects LSports’ continued expansion in Latin America, where the supplier has been increasing its commercial and technical presence while developing products tailored to regional market requirements.
The agreement adds Caliente to LSports’ roster of operator partners and further extends the supplier’s presence in one of the fastest-growing regions for regulated sports betting and iGaming.
